    So many good albums of 2016.

    Favorite:
    The Monkees Good Times - what an amazing surprise this album turned out to be!

    Honorable Mentions:
    Relient K, Air for Free - a mature, Beatlesque effort. Several songs veer into McCartney territory that sound more like song suites. Check out "Local Construction."

    Regina Spektor, Remember Us To Life - loving it so far.

    Needtobreathe, Hard Love - They just keep getting better. Money and Fame rocks NEEDTOBREATHE - “MONEY & FAME ” [Official Audio] »

    M. Ward, More Rain - a more upbeat, percussion heavy effort than anything else he's ever released. Great stuff.

    Emitt Rhodes, Rainbow Ends - Can't believe he put out such a good album after so many years. Heartbreaking and wonderful.

    Crowder, American Prodigal - It's hillbilly and modern at the same time. Here's a taste Crowder - Prove It (Audio) ft. KB »
